27 /*
28  * @(#)Id: readelf.h,v 1.9 2002/05/16 18:45:56 christos Exp
29  *
30  * Provide elf data structures for non-elf machines, allowing file
31  * non-elf hosts to determine if an elf binary is stripped.
32  * Note: cobbled from the linux header file, with modifications
33  */
34 #ifndef __fake_elf_h__
35 #define	__fake_elf_h__
36 
37 #if HAVE_STDINT_H
38 #include <stdint.h>
39 #endif
40 
41 typedef uint32_t	Elf32_Addr;
42 typedef uint32_t	Elf32_Off;
43 typedef uint16_t	Elf32_Half;
44 typedef uint32_t	Elf32_Word;
45 typedef uint8_t		Elf32_Char;
46 
47 typedef	uint64_t 	Elf64_Addr;
48 typedef	uint64_t 	Elf64_Off;
49 typedef uint64_t 	Elf64_Xword;
50 typedef uint16_t	Elf64_Half;
51 typedef uint32_t	Elf64_Word;
52 typedef uint8_t		Elf64_Char;
53 
54 #define	EI_NIDENT	16
55 
56 typedef struct {
57     Elf32_Char	e_ident[EI_NIDENT];
58     Elf32_Half	e_type;
59     Elf32_Half	e_machine;
60     Elf32_Word	e_version;
61     Elf32_Addr	e_entry;  /* Entry point */
62     Elf32_Off	e_phoff;
63     Elf32_Off	e_shoff;
64     Elf32_Word	e_flags;
65     Elf32_Half	e_ehsize;
66     Elf32_Half	e_phentsize;
67     Elf32_Half	e_phnum;
68     Elf32_Half	e_shentsize;
69     Elf32_Half	e_shnum;
70     Elf32_Half	e_shstrndx;
71 } Elf32_Ehdr;
72 
73 typedef struct {
74     Elf64_Char	e_ident[EI_NIDENT];
75     Elf64_Half	e_type;
76     Elf64_Half	e_machine;
77     Elf64_Word	e_version;
78     Elf64_Addr	e_entry;  /* Entry point */
79     Elf64_Off	e_phoff;
80     Elf64_Off	e_shoff;
81     Elf64_Word	e_flags;
82     Elf64_Half	e_ehsize;
83     Elf64_Half	e_phentsize;
84     Elf64_Half	e_phnum;
85     Elf64_Half	e_shentsize;
86     Elf64_Half	e_shnum;
87     Elf64_Half	e_shstrndx;
88 } Elf64_Ehdr;
89 
90 /* e_type */
91 #define	ET_REL		1
92 #define	ET_EXEC		2
93 #define	ET_DYN		3
94 #define	ET_CORE		4
95 
96 /* e_machine (used only for SunOS 5.x hardware capabilities) */
97 #define	EM_SPARC	2
98 #define	EM_386		3
99 #define	EM_SPARC32PLUS	18
100 #define	EM_SPARCV9	43
101 #define	EM_IA_64	50
102 #define	EM_AMD64	62
103 
104 /* sh_type */
105 #define	SHT_SYMTAB	2
106 #define	SHT_NOTE	7
107 #define	SHT_DYNSYM	11
108 #define	SHT_SUNW_cap	0x6ffffff5	/* SunOS 5.x hw/sw capabilites */
109 
110 /* elf type */
111 #define	ELFDATANONE	0		/* e_ident[EI_DATA] */
112 #define	ELFDATA2LSB	1
113 #define	ELFDATA2MSB	2
114 
115 /* elf class */
116 #define	ELFCLASSNONE	0
117 #define	ELFCLASS32	1
118 #define	ELFCLASS64	2
119 
120 /* magic number */
121 #define	EI_MAG0		0		/* e_ident[] indexes */
122 #define	EI_MAG1		1
123 #define	EI_MAG2		2
124 #define	EI_MAG3		3
125 #define	EI_CLASS	4
126 #define	EI_DATA		5
127 #define	EI_VERSION	6
128 #define	EI_PAD		7
129 
130 #define	ELFMAG0		0x7f		/* EI_MAG */
131 #define	ELFMAG1		'E'
132 #define	ELFMAG2		'L'
133 #define	ELFMAG3		'F'
134 #define	ELFMAG		"\177ELF"
135 
136 #define	OLFMAG1		'O'
137 #define	OLFMAG		"\177OLF"
138 
139 typedef struct {
140     Elf32_Word	p_type;
141     Elf32_Off	p_offset;
142     Elf32_Addr	p_vaddr;
143     Elf32_Addr	p_paddr;
144     Elf32_Word	p_filesz;
145     Elf32_Word	p_memsz;
146     Elf32_Word	p_flags;
147     Elf32_Word	p_align;
148 } Elf32_Phdr;
149 
150 typedef struct {
151     Elf64_Word	p_type;
152     Elf64_Word	p_flags;
153     Elf64_Off	p_offset;
154     Elf64_Addr	p_vaddr;
155     Elf64_Addr	p_paddr;
156     Elf64_Xword	p_filesz;
157     Elf64_Xword	p_memsz;
158     Elf64_Xword	p_align;
159 } Elf64_Phdr;
160 
161 #define	PT_NULL		0		/* p_type */
162 #define	PT_LOAD		1
163 #define	PT_DYNAMIC	2
164 #define	PT_INTERP	3
165 #define	PT_NOTE		4
166 #define	PT_SHLIB	5
167 #define	PT_PHDR		6
168 #define	PT_NUM		7
169 
170 typedef struct {
171     Elf32_Word	sh_name;
172     Elf32_Word	sh_type;
173     Elf32_Word	sh_flags;
174     Elf32_Addr	sh_addr;
175     Elf32_Off	sh_offset;
176     Elf32_Word	sh_size;
177     Elf32_Word	sh_link;
178     Elf32_Word	sh_info;
179     Elf32_Word	sh_addralign;
180     Elf32_Word	sh_entsize;
181 } Elf32_Shdr;
182 
183 typedef struct {
184     Elf64_Word	sh_name;
185     Elf64_Word	sh_type;
186     Elf64_Off	sh_flags;
187     Elf64_Addr	sh_addr;
188     Elf64_Off	sh_offset;
189     Elf64_Off	sh_size;
190     Elf64_Word	sh_link;
191     Elf64_Word	sh_info;
192     Elf64_Off	sh_addralign;
193     Elf64_Off	sh_entsize;
194 } Elf64_Shdr;
195 
196 #define	NT_NETBSD_CORE_PROCINFO		1
197 
198 /* Note header in a PT_NOTE section */
199 typedef struct elf_note {
200     Elf32_Word	n_namesz;	/* Name size */
201     Elf32_Word	n_descsz;	/* Content size */
202     Elf32_Word	n_type;		/* Content type */
203 } Elf32_Nhdr;
204 
205 typedef struct {
206     Elf64_Word	n_namesz;
207     Elf64_Word	n_descsz;
208     Elf64_Word	n_type;
209 } Elf64_Nhdr;
210 
211 /* Notes used in ET_CORE */
212 #define	NT_PRSTATUS	1
213 #define	NT_PRFPREG	2
214 #define	NT_PRPSINFO	3
215 #define	NT_PRXREG	4
216 #define	NT_TASKSTRUCT	4
217 #define	NT_PLATFORM	5
218 #define	NT_AUXV		6
219 
220 /* Note types used in executables */
221 /* NetBSD executables (name = "NetBSD") */
222 #define	NT_NETBSD_VERSION	1
223 #define	NT_NETBSD_EMULATION	2
224 #define	NT_FREEBSD_VERSION	1
225 #define	NT_OPENBSD_VERSION	1
226 #define	NT_DRAGONFLY_VERSION	1
227 /*
228  * GNU executables (name = "GNU")
229  * word[0]: GNU OS tags
230  * word[1]: major version
231  * word[2]: minor version
232  * word[3]: tiny version
233  */
234 #define	NT_GNU_VERSION		1
235 
236 /* GNU OS tags */
237 #define	GNU_OS_LINUX	0
238 #define	GNU_OS_HURD	1
239 #define	GNU_OS_SOLARIS	2
240 #define	GNU_OS_KFREEBSD	3
241 #define	GNU_OS_KNETBSD	4
242 
243 /*
244  * GNU Hardware capability information
245  * word[0]: Number of entries
246  * word[1]: Bitmask of enabled entries
247  * Followed by a byte id, and a NUL terminated string per entry
248  */
249 #define	NT_GNU_HWCAP		2
250 
251 /*
252  * GNU Build ID generated by ld
253  * 160 bit SHA1 [default]
254  * 128 bit md5 or uuid
255  */
256 #define	NT_GNU_BUILD_ID		3
257 
258 /*
259  * NetBSD-specific note type: PaX.
260  * There should be 1 NOTE per executable.
261  * name: PaX\0
262  * namesz: 4
263  * desc:
264  *	word[0]: capability bitmask
265  * descsz: 4
266  */
267 #define NT_NETBSD_PAX		3
268 #define NT_NETBSD_PAX_MPROTECT		0x01	/* Force enable Mprotect */
269 #define NT_NETBSD_PAX_NOMPROTECT	0x02	/* Force disable Mprotect */
270 #define NT_NETBSD_PAX_GUARD		0x04	/* Force enable Segvguard */
271 #define NT_NETBSD_PAX_NOGUARD		0x08	/* Force disable Servguard */
272 #define NT_NETBSD_PAX_ASLR		0x10	/* Force enable ASLR */
273 #define NT_NETBSD_PAX_NOASLR		0x20	/* Force disable ASLR */
274 
275 /*
276  * NetBSD-specific note type: MACHINE_ARCH.
277  * There should be 1 NOTE per executable.
278  * name:	NetBSD\0
279  * namesz:	7
280  * desc:	string
281  * descsz:	variable
282  */
283 #define NT_NETBSD_MARCH		5
284 
285 /*
286  * NetBSD-specific note type: COMPILER MODEL.
287  * There should be 1 NOTE per executable.
288  * name:	NetBSD\0
289  * namesz:	7
290  * desc:	string
291  * descsz:	variable
292  */
293 #define NT_NETBSD_CMODEL	6
294 
295 #if !defined(ELFSIZE) && defined(ARCH_ELFSIZE)
296 #define ELFSIZE ARCH_ELFSIZE
297 #endif
298 /* SunOS 5.x hardware/software capabilities */
299 typedef struct {
300 	Elf32_Word	c_tag;
301 	union {
302 		Elf32_Word	c_val;
303 		Elf32_Addr	c_ptr;
304 	} c_un;
305 } Elf32_Cap;
306 
307 typedef struct {
308 	Elf64_Xword	c_tag;
309 	union {
310 		Elf64_Xword	c_val;
311 		Elf64_Addr	c_ptr;
312 	} c_un;
313 } Elf64_Cap;
314 
315 /* SunOS 5.x hardware/software capability tags */
316 #define	CA_SUNW_NULL	0
317 #define	CA_SUNW_HW_1	1
318 #define	CA_SUNW_SF_1	2
319 
320 /* SunOS 5.x software capabilities */
321 #define	SF1_SUNW_FPKNWN	0x01
322 #define	SF1_SUNW_FPUSED	0x02
323 #define	SF1_SUNW_MASK	0x03
324 
325 /* SunOS 5.x hardware capabilities: sparc */
326 #define	AV_SPARC_MUL32		0x0001
327 #define	AV_SPARC_DIV32		0x0002
328 #define	AV_SPARC_FSMULD		0x0004
329 #define	AV_SPARC_V8PLUS		0x0008
330 #define	AV_SPARC_POPC		0x0010
331 #define	AV_SPARC_VIS		0x0020
332 #define	AV_SPARC_VIS2		0x0040
333 #define	AV_SPARC_ASI_BLK_INIT	0x0080
334 #define	AV_SPARC_FMAF		0x0100
335 #define	AV_SPARC_FJFMAU		0x4000
336 #define	AV_SPARC_IMA		0x8000
337 
338 /* SunOS 5.x hardware capabilities: 386 */
339 #define	AV_386_FPU		0x00000001
340 #define	AV_386_TSC		0x00000002
341 #define	AV_386_CX8		0x00000004
342 #define	AV_386_SEP		0x00000008
343 #define	AV_386_AMD_SYSC		0x00000010
344 #define	AV_386_CMOV		0x00000020
345 #define	AV_386_MMX		0x00000040
346 #define	AV_386_AMD_MMX		0x00000080
347 #define	AV_386_AMD_3DNow	0x00000100
348 #define	AV_386_AMD_3DNowx	0x00000200
349 #define	AV_386_FXSR		0x00000400
350 #define	AV_386_SSE		0x00000800
351 #define	AV_386_SSE2		0x00001000
352 #define	AV_386_PAUSE		0x00002000
353 #define	AV_386_SSE3		0x00004000
354 #define	AV_386_MON		0x00008000
355 #define	AV_386_CX16		0x00010000
356 #define	AV_386_AHF		0x00020000
357 #define	AV_386_TSCP		0x00040000
358 #define	AV_386_AMD_SSE4A	0x00080000
359 #define	AV_386_POPCNT		0x00100000
360 #define	AV_386_AMD_LZCNT	0x00200000
361 #define	AV_386_SSSE3		0x00400000
362 #define	AV_386_SSE4_1		0x00800000
363 #define	AV_386_SSE4_2		0x01000000
364 
365 #endif
